In the realm of scientific research, Deoxycholic acid stands out for its utility as a biological detergent. As a component of bile, it aids in fat digestion, but in the laboratory, its primary value lies in its ability to disrupt cell membranes and solubilize proteins and other cellular components. This makes deoxycholic acid cell lysis a fundamental technique enabled by this compound.

The effectiveness of Deoxycholic acid as a bile acid detergent is widely exploited in biochemistry and molecular biology. Researchers rely on its consistent performance for isolating membrane proteins, extracting nucleic acids, and preparing samples for various analytical techniques.
